Vapor barrier installation in Bullitt County, KY, typically involves selecting appropriate materials and understanding the scope of work required for effective moisture control in various building types. This overview provides general information to help compare options and estimate project considerations for vapor barrier projects.

  • Materials: Common vapor barrier materials include polyethylene sheets of varying thicknesses, usually 6 to 10 mil, suitable for different applications such as crawl spaces or basements.
  • Size and Scope: Projects can range from small crawl space areas to larger basement or slab applications, with coverage depending on the space size and specific moisture control needs.
  • Labor Complexity: Installation generally involves laying out and securing the barrier material, with complexity influenced by space accessibility and the need for sealing seams and penetrations.
  • Permitting: Local regulations in Bullitt County may require permits for vapor barrier installation, especially in new construction or major renovation projects.
  • Extras: Additional considerations may include sealing around vents, pipes, and other penetrations, as well as applying protective coatings or insulation over the vapor barrier for enhanced performance.
